Georgian Foreign Minister ,Grigol Vashadze, who is at present on a tour to Europe, said that foreign-policy course of Georgia will not change after the new government comes to power, as the European way is the choice of the people.
According to the Georgian Foreign Ministry, Vashadze has held meetings with foreign ministers of the Czech Republic, Slovakia and Austria, visiting the capitals of the three countries.
“Georgia is neither a post-Soviet country, nor the country of new democracy. Georgia is a European country, where not only democratic elections are held, but the power is transferred democratically,” said Vashadze.
